¿Cómo configurar el orden de ejecución de los interceptores?
La ejecución de los interceptores respeta el orden en que aparecen en los flujos de entrada y salida de las llamadas. Para las peticiones de entrada (del cliente al servidor), el orden de ejecución es de la izquierda para la derecha. Para las respuestas (del servidor al cliente), el orden es de la derecha para la izquierda.
Este orden se establece durante la configuración del flujo y se puede editar fácilmente.
Para editar el orden de los interceptores en un flujo:
-
Acceda a la tarjeta de la API;
-
En la pantalla Your API Overview, acceda a la sección Flows;
-
Haga clic en EDIT;
-
Arrastre y suelte el interceptor en la posición deseada, como se muestra en el ejemplo a continuación.
En la ilustración de abajo, movimos el interceptor IP Filtering antes del interceptor OAuth. Esto optimiza el proceso para que solo las peticiones que pasen por el IP filtering tengan sus credenciales validadas. En la configuración anterior, todas las peticiones pasarían por la validación antes de ser filtradas por IP. Editar el orden de los interceptores
|
Si no puede cambiar el orden de los interceptores, vea si hay otro flujo que los haya originado. Los interceptores heredados de otro flujo aparecen en gris y no pueden ser editados.
|
Share your suggestions with us!
Click here and then [+ Submit idea]